When you book Cinderella's Royal Table, you'll have to include your son as an adult on the reservation, and pay accordingly. However, this may actually end up being a good thing in the long run.
Once my son was considered an adult on our Disney Dining Plan (he's 11 now, too), it actually opened up options that may not have been investigated had he been solely looking at the kids' menu. At many table service locations, we've explained that our younger eaters (or even my sometimes-finicky husband) simply don't see anything on the traditional menu that appeals to them, and the server has been very helpful in finding an alternative (often from the kids' menu). An adult-sized portion of some items from the kids' menu can sometimes be substituted for an entree or a side dish or two, if you simply ask. Take a look at
Cinderella's Royal Table's menu for a better idea of what your little prince may be interested in ordering.
